Output 51135573f6081a3d16afbef7a435133117d0c8031f182e175be061df80df0c6e:0

value
6848134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bad8f1a08cb7dbf59ace5265a716d8430d2d784 OP_EQUAL
address
MKB7G7eaKhfb52z82ptXTBdgSXBaMfxPPe
transaction
51135573f6081a3d16afbef7a435133117d0c8031f182e175be061df80df0c6e
spent
true